Alabama White BBQ
$9.99 – $79.99
Ethnic Palate: Southern American
Pairing: Pilsner, Chardonnay
Historic Description: Alabama White BBQ sauce is a vinegar-based, mayonnaise-heavy sauce that originated in Northern Alabama in the 1920s. It’s used primarily on chicken and pork, and it found its way into the wing scene in Southern-style BBQ restaurants

Buffalo Hot
$9.99 – $79.99
Ethnic Palate: American
Pairing: IPA, Zinfandel
Historic Description: Buffalo Hot sticks close to the original Buffalo recipe, which was first introduced at the Anchor Bar in 1964. It's a signature flavor in American wing culture and is most commonly found in U.S. sports bars, diners, and takeout restaurants

Jamaican Jerk
$9.99 – $79.99
Ethnic Palate: Caribbean
Pairing: Lager, Rum-based cocktails
Historic Description: Jamaican jerk seasoning dates back to indigenous Arawak cooking, and today it’s a staple in Caribbean cuisine. This spicy, fragrant blend is used on chicken and pork across Jamaica and Caribbean communities worldwide

Sweet Chili
$9.99 – $79.99
Ethnic Palate: Southeast Asian, Thai
Pairing: Belgian Ale, Riesling
Historic Description: Sweet chili sauce originates from Thailand, where it's often used as a dipping sauce for spring rolls and fried dishes. In recent decades, it has gained global popularity, particularly in the U.S. as a wing sauce
